What is an Ethical Stocks and Shares ISA?
An ethical stocks and shares ISA is a tax-efficient investment account that allows you to invest in companies that have been screened for their ethical practices These companies typically have strong environmental, social, and governance (ESG) practices, meaning they are committed to sustainability, social responsibility, and ethical business practices By investing in these companies, you can support positive change in the world while also potentially earning a return on your investment.

Considerations When Choosing an Ethical Stocks and Shares ISA
When choosing an ethical stocks and shares ISA, there are several factors to consider First, it’s important to carefully review the fund’s ethical screening process to ensure it aligns with your values Some funds may have stricter criteria than others, so make sure you understand the fund’s approach to ethical investing.
Additionally, you should consider the fund’s performance track record, fees, and investment strategy While ethical investing is important, it’s also crucial to ensure that your investment is generating a competitive return Look for funds that have a strong track record of delivering consistent returns and reasonable fees.
Finally, consider the diversification and risk profile of the fund Diversification is key to managing risk in your investment portfolio, so look for funds that have a diverse range of holdings across different sectors and regions Additionally, consider your own risk tolerance and investment goals when choosing an ethical stocks and shares ISA.
